Who was Pyotr Chernyshev?
Pyotr Sergeevich Chernyshev was a Chief Engineer of the Leningradsky Metallichesky Zavod, a major pipe-construction specialist. Formerly a Soviet figure skater, four time national figure skating champion. Stalin Prize winner for the development of steam turbines of high pressure.
His grandson Peter Tchernyshev represented the U.S. in ice dancing.
